Wondering if there's been any further progression on Windows support for ThreatMapper? There's a tremendous use case and need for it in the public domain (we've been advocating ThreatMapper and deploying it across many of our customer environments and the blaring gap at the moment is the lack of Windows support).
Agree that DevOps env's tend to be Linux flavoured for the most part but through real-world observations, we've drawn to conclusions based on highly prevalent scenarios and feedback:
-
Most users of Azure cloud tend to have a higher Windows to Linux VM ratio, which limits the recognised benefit of ThreatMapper, and;
-
Most org's that have a strong DevOps culture will tend to have their static corporate services workloads running on Windows.
Would be great to get an official update on the Windows roadmap.
